President Obama starts his day with his daily briefing at 9:45 a.m. and his economic briefing at 10:15 a.m. He meets with senior advisers at 10:45 a.m.
At 11:35 a.m., the president addresses the state of the economy in remarks delivered at Georgetown University.
White House Press Secretary Robert Gibbs holds the daily press briefing at 1:00 p.m.
Continuing her federal agencies tour, Michelle Obama is expected to visit the Department of Homeland Security this morning. She'll meet with Secretary Janet Napolitano and other top agency officials.
